I'm building one this weekend, Gonna use 10" pneumatic tires with threaded rod for and axle. Attach to a piece of plywood to set the boat on, and cover with old scrap carpet.

Easy DIY project for under 30 bucks. Alot better than spending 60-100 for one that isnt custom fit to your boat.
